Darren Pilgrim <freebsd at bitfreak.org> writes:

> I'm unable to unmount an idle filesystem (or even drop it to
> read-only):
>
> # umount /usr/ports
> umount: unmount of /usr/ports failed: Device busy

Do you have HAL daemon running?

I recently had the same problem, and it turned out that momentaneously
shutting down the daemon allowed me to unmount filesystems. See
/usr/local/etc/rc.d/hald.

Hope this helps.

Note: the HAL daemon is used by desktop environments like Gnome or
Xfce, so if you use on of them, it is likely you have HAL daemon
running.
